隨著航空業(yè)的快速發(fā)展,飛機(jī)票在線預(yù)訂系統(tǒng)已成為現(xiàn)代旅行的核心組成部分。本文介紹一個(gè)基于Spring Boot框架開發(fā)的航空票務(wù)預(yù)訂系統(tǒng),該系統(tǒng)整合了數(shù)據(jù)處理服務(wù),為用戶提供便捷、高效的機(jī)票預(yù)訂體驗(yàn)。
一、系統(tǒng)概述
本系統(tǒng)采用Spring Boot作為后端開發(fā)框架,利用其自動(dòng)配置、快速啟動(dòng)和微服務(wù)支持等特性,構(gòu)建了一個(gè)穩(wěn)定可靠的飛機(jī)票在線預(yù)訂平臺(tái)。系統(tǒng)核心功能包括航班查詢、座位選擇、在線支付、訂單管理以及用戶賬戶服務(wù)。通過(guò)模塊化設(shè)計(jì),系統(tǒng)實(shí)現(xiàn)了高內(nèi)聚低耦合的架構(gòu),便于維護(hù)和擴(kuò)展。
二、技術(shù)架構(gòu)
Spring Boot框架為系統(tǒng)提供了強(qiáng)大的技術(shù)支持,包括:
數(shù)據(jù)處理服務(wù)采用MySQL數(shù)據(jù)庫(kù)存儲(chǔ)航班信息、用戶數(shù)據(jù)和訂單記錄。系統(tǒng)通過(guò)RESTful API提供前端交互,確保數(shù)據(jù)的一致性和實(shí)時(shí)性。
三、核心功能實(shí)現(xiàn)
四、數(shù)據(jù)處理服務(wù)優(yōu)化
為提高系統(tǒng)性能,數(shù)據(jù)處理服務(wù)采用以下策略:
五、系統(tǒng)測(cè)試與部署
系統(tǒng)在開發(fā)過(guò)程中進(jìn)行了單元測(cè)試和集成測(cè)試,使用JUnit和Mockito確保代碼質(zhì)量。部署時(shí),可通過(guò)Docker容器化技術(shù)實(shí)現(xiàn)快速部署和擴(kuò)展。
六、總結(jié)與展望
本系統(tǒng)基于Spring Boot框架,成功實(shí)現(xiàn)了一個(gè)功能完善的航空票務(wù)預(yù)訂平臺(tái)。未來(lái)可擴(kuò)展功能包括智能推薦、多語(yǔ)言支持和移動(dòng)端適配,以提升用戶體驗(yàn)。該系統(tǒng)不僅適用于畢業(yè)設(shè)計(jì),也為實(shí)際應(yīng)用提供了參考。
通過(guò)本項(xiàng)目的開發(fā),我們深入理解了Spring Boot在現(xiàn)代Web應(yīng)用中的優(yōu)勢(shì),以及數(shù)據(jù)處理服務(wù)在業(yè)務(wù)系統(tǒng)中的關(guān)鍵作用。
如若轉(zhuǎn)載,請(qǐng)注明出處:http://m.zunda.net/product/18.html
更新時(shí)間:2026-05-16 07:00:01